What is Argan Oil?

Benefits of Argan Oil for BeardsArgan oil is derived from the Argan tree. The tree is found in Morocco, and the oil has been used for centuries by the people in that region. The oil is used for a variety of purposes, including as a skin moisturizer, a hair conditioner, and even as a cooking oil.

The oil is rich in Vitamin E and essential fatty acids, which makes it beneficial for both skin and hair. Argan oil can help to moisturize the skin and make the hair softer and shinier. It is also said to help with the growth of facial hair.

Can Argan Oil Help with Beard Growth?

Can Argan Oil Help with Beard Growth?If you’re looking for a natural way to help with beard growth, you may have come across argan oil. Argan oil is a natural oil derived from the nuts of the argan tree, and it has long been used in Morocco for its skin and hair benefits.

Recent studies have shown that argan oil can help with hair growth, and it’s thought to be due to its high content of antioxidants and fatty acids. Argan oil can help to nourish the hair follicles and scalp, which can promote healthy hair growth.

How to Use Argan Oil for Your Beard

Argan oil is the new talk of the town when it comes to beard care. This natural oil, derived from the Argan tree, is packed with antioxidants, vitamins, and essential fatty acids that nourish the skin and hair.

Plus, it has a pleasant, nutty scent that will leave your beard smelling great all day long.

So, how do you use argan oil for your beard? Here’s a step-by-step guide:

  • Start with a clean, dry beard. Either wash your beard with a mild shampoo or simply rinse it with water.
  • Next, take a small amount of argan oil and rub it between your palms.
  • Apply the oil to your beard, starting from the base and working your way up to the tips.
  • Use a comb or brush to evenly distribute the oil.
  • For best results, let the oil soak into your beard for at least 30 minutes before washing it off.
